Giant Prehistoric Scorpion: The Size of a Baseball Bat! 🦂 | Ancient Monster Revealed (2026)

The discovery of a colossal scorpion fossil, Praearcturus gigas, measuring over 3 feet in length, has sparked a fascinating debate among scientists. This ancient creature, estimated to have lived around 415 million years ago in what is now Great Britain, challenges our understanding of scorpion evolution and the boundaries between land and water habitats. The fossil, initially misidentified as a crustacean, was only recognized as a scorpion after a meticulous examination of its remains and the use of advanced imaging techniques.

What makes this discovery even more captivating is the potential implications for our understanding of scorpion evolution. The fossil's size and features, such as its long and triangular sternum, suggest a close relationship with modern scorpions. However, the fact that it lived in an aquatic environment during a time when oxygen levels were lower than today raises questions about the evolution of scorpion habitats and behaviors. Was Praearcturus gigas a fully aquatic creature, or did it have a dual land-water lifestyle? These questions underscore the complexity of scorpion evolution and the need for further research.

One thing that immediately stands out is the fossil's size. At over 3 feet in length, it dwarfs modern-day scorpions, which typically measure between 4 and 5 inches. This size difference raises the question of how such a large scorpion could have survived on land, given the limited food sources available. The team's hypothesis that Praearcturus gigas lived an amphibious lifestyle, feeding on primitive fish, provides a plausible explanation for its size and habitat.
